What's The Definition Of Retread?
retread
If you describe something such as a book, film, or song as a retread, you mean that it contains ideas or elements that have been used before, and that it is not very interesting or original. retread in American English recap1 noun: a tire that has been retreaded transitive verb: to put a new tread on (a worn pneumatic tire casing) either by recapping or by cutting fresh treads in the smooth surface retread in British English verb |
